Section 1: Emerging Trends in Network Disaster Recovery
The field of disaster recovery is constantly evolving, driven by advances in technology and the increasing complexity of network systems. One of the latest trends is the rise of cloud-based disaster recovery solutions, which offer greater flexibility, scalability, and cost-effectiveness. Another trend is the growing importance of art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ning (ML) in disaster recovery, enabling organizations to detect and respond to threats more quickly and effectively. Section 2: Innovations in Network Resilience and Security
As network systems become more sophisticated, so do the threats they face. To stay ahead of these threats, organizations are investing in innovative solutions that enhance network resilience and security. One such innovation is the development of software-defined networking (SDN), which enables organizations to create highly adaptable and secure networks. Another innovation is the use of blockchain technology to secure network transactions and prevent data breaches. Section 3: Future Developments in Disaster Recovery and Network Systems
Looking ahead, the future of disaster recovery and network systems holds much promise. One area of development is the integration of Internet of Things (IoT) devices into network systems, which will require new approaches to disaster recovery and security. Another area is the growing importance of edge computing, which will enable organizations to process data closer to the source, reducing latency and improving network performance.
